Gutter Repair vs. Replacement in Northampton, PA

Situation Recommendation Rationale
Single seam leaking after frost cycles cycle Repair Resealing an isolated seam restores function when the surrounding gutter run is otherwise sound and properly pitched.
Gutter sagging from failed hanger spikes Repair Replacing spikes with hidden hangers corrects the sag and restores proper pitch without disturbing the gutter run.
Minor pitch problem causing standing water Repair Gutter pitch correction stops mosquito breeding and ice dam buildup without requiring a full gutter replacement.
Clogged downspout causing overflow damage Repair Clearing the downspout and adding an extension resolves the overflow and protects foundation grading from further erosion.
Sectional gutters with multiple failing seams Replace Gutter replacement with seamless aluminum eliminates all seam water intrusion points and performs better through Northampton's repeated frost cycles.
Fascia rotted behind gutter run Replace Rotted fascia cannot hold hangers securely, so gutter replacement must follow the wood repair to prevent rehang failure; consider exterior painting services on the new fascia to protect against future moisture.
Gutters older than 20 years with widespread corrosion Replace Older sectional gutters with pervasive corrosion have passed their service life and gutter replacement delivers better long-term value than repeated patchwork.

Q: How often should gutters be cleaned in Northampton, PA?

A: Homes in Northampton, PA with heavy tree canopy, particularly in the Atlas Park and 21st Street neighborhoods, should schedule gutter maintenance at least twice a year, once after the fall leaf drop and once in late spring after maple seed and pine debris finish falling. Properties with overhanging branches close to the roofline may benefit from a third pass after major wind events given the area's 46 inches of annual rainfall.

A: Sectional gutters are assembled from pre-cut lengths joined by seams, and those seams are the most common failure point after Northampton's repeated cold-weather expansion cycles. Seamless gutters are formed in a single continuous run on-site, eliminating interior seam joints and significantly reducing the gutter repair calls that follow hard winters. For most Northampton Borough homes, gutter installation using seamless aluminum is the more reliable long-term solution given the humid continental climate.

A: Gutter guards reduce the frequency of cleaning, but they do not eliminate it entirely for homes in Northampton, PA. Fine debris, shingle grit, and small seeds work past most guard systems over time, and the guards themselves need to be cleared periodically to stay effective. Gutter maintenance remains necessary at least once a year even with guards installed, and an annual inspection catches pitch drift or hanger issues early before they require full gutter replacement.

A: If a craftsman finds soft or discolored wood behind the gutter run during a gutter repair or removal, the fascia board should be addressed before the new gutter is rehung, because fasteners driven into rotted wood will not hold through a Northampton winter. Soffit repair is recommended when overflow or winter roof ice damage has worked behind the fascia edge. Deferring the wood repair and re-hanging the gutter over damaged substrate typically leads to a repeat failure within a season or two.

A: Northampton, PA sits in a humid continental zone with cold winters reaching into the low 20s and significant annual snowfall, conditions that stress aluminum sectional gutters at every seam joint. Seamless aluminum handles winter freezing cycling well and is the most common gutter installation choice in the Lehigh Valley. Copper gutters are a premium option that resists corrosion and patinas attractively over time, but the cost difference is substantial and most Northampton homeowners find seamless aluminum meets their drainage needs effectively for decades.

A: Keeping the downspout extensions clear and angled away from the foundation is the single most effective maintenance step a Northampton homeowner can take between gutter service visits. Trimming branches that overhang the roofline reduces the leaf and debris volume that enters the system each season. After any significant ice event, check for hanger pull-away or pitch change along the gutter run, as the weight of ice is the leading cause of hanger failure in this climate.
